We found more intel on the rumored Porsche Cayman Clubsport.
Called the Clubsport, the new version Cayman will be powered by the same 3.4 liter flat six engine only tricked to deliver between 320 and 330 HP. Engineers will also focus on reducing the car’s total weight as much as possible, most likely by applying the same treatment as with the Boxster Spyder. All of this will allow the Clubsport to make the 0-60 mph sprint in less than five seconds and reach a top speed of 155 mph.
Next to the improved engine, the future Cayman Clubsport will also offer a sport suspension, a new brake system, a lower center of gravity, and Porsche’s latest PDK double-clutch gearbox. The base version will come equipped with the Sports Chrono package, while the high performance version will get an aerodynamic package.
Price will be in the $60K area (at the current exchange rates).
